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Burneside (Cumbria) to Enfield Chase start from as little as £43.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Burneside (Cumbria) to Enfield Chase start from £93.20 one way, or £133.20 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Burneside (Cumbria) to Enfield Chase are available for £194.90 one way, or £389.80 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

Burneside station may be small, but it serves its purpose efficiently with essential facilities to accommodate travelers. While there is no ticket office, you'll find a ticket machine available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. This machine is accessible to all, including those who might need additional accessibility features such as an induction loop. Although there is no staff on site, assistance can be obtained from the conductor once your train arrives.

While not overflowing with amenities, the station is equipped with basic comforts necessary for a smooth travel experience. CCTV coverage ensures safety, and there are customer help points available should you need assistance. Keep in mind, however, that there's no waiting room, so if you're planning to wait, consider the weather as there are no seating areas.

Travel Connections and Accessibility

Even with its old-world charm, Burneside Station is well-connected to a variety of transport links. For rail replacement services, directions are available either towards Oxenholme or Windermere. If you need a taxi, the Northern Railway's Cab4You service can facilitate your arrangements. Meanwhile, bicycle storage is available on Platform 1, making it easy for travelers who prefer to cycle. Though bicycle hire is not an option at Burneside, its accessibility ensures seamless coordination with other modes of transport.

If you're planning to travel via bus, convenient connections are just steps away. Assistance with organizing your journey is right at your fingertips with printable resources available online for peace of mind.

Facilities At Enfield Chase Station

The station is equipped with ticket-buying facilities to cater to a variety of passenger needs. With ticket machines available, securing your travel tickets is a hassle-free task. Additionally, these machines are accessible, supporting those who use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. While smartcard services are offered, it’s worth noting that the station doesn’t support Wi-Fi or provide a visible ATM, so plan accordingly.

For those looking for a helping hand, staff assistance at Enfield Chase is available from 5:00 AM to 1:00 AM, offering support during most travel times. The accessibility offerings, however, are a bit limited, as the station lacks step-free access and essential amenities such as accessible toilets. Nonetheless, there is a heated waiting room on Platform 1, offering some comfort during cooler days.

Onward Travel From Enfield Chase

In terms of onward connections, Enfield Chase is well-linked with alternative transport options. While rail replacement services are available during disruptions, detailed onward travel plans can be explored through maps provided at the station. Although there's no direct provision for car rental services at the station, local bus stops and taxi services are easily accessible, presenting a variety of ways to continue your journey. Drivers will be glad to know there's a modest car parking lot managed by APCOA, offering free parking.
